Blood agar is an example of?
Correct Answer: Enriched media
Description: ANSWER: (A) Enriched mediaREF: Essentials of diagnostic microbiology by Lisa Anne Shimeld, Anne T. Rodgers page 93, Laboratory Diagnosis of Infectious Diseases: Essentials of Diagnostic Microbiology by Paul G. Engelkirk, Janet Duben-Engelkirk page 190See APPENDIX-82 below for "CATEGORIES OF ARTIFICIAL MEDIA"Enriched media has one or more added substances to increase the likelihood of growth of fastidious organisms. The added substances include blood or serum products or vitamins. Some commonly used enriched media include blood agar, chocolate agar, Loffler's serum slope, and LJ medium APPENDIX-82CATEGORIES OF ARTIFICIAL MEDIA:MediaDescriptionExampleEnrichedmediaOne or more added substance (blood, serum, vitamins) to increase the likelihood of growth of fastidious organismsBlood agar,Chocolate agar,Lofflers serum slope,U mediumDifferentialmediaUsed to distinguish types of bacteria by addition of substances that wall be changed as a result of metabolic activity of the bacteriaEosin methylene blue, MacConkey's media,Mannitol salt sugarEnrichmentmediaLiquid media that simulates growrth of certain bacteria or suppresses the growth of other for isolation of desired pathological bacteriaSelenite-F broth,Tetrathionate brothSelectivemediaSolid media that inhibits the growth of all but few bacteria and at the same time facilitates isolation of certain bacteriaTCBS (Thiosulfate citrate bile salt sucrose agar selective for V cholerae),DC A (Deoxycholate citrate agar selective for salmonella & shigella), LJ medium selective for M. tuberculosis,MSA (mannitol salt agar selective for Gram +ve),XLD (Xylose lysine deoxycholate selective for Gram -ve ),Buffered charcoal yeast extract agar (selective for legionella)TransportmediaUsed to maintain the viability of certain organisms in clinical specimens during their transport to the laboratory. They typically contains only buffer and salt.Stuart medium for gonococciIndicatormediaContains indicator that changes colour when bacterium grows in itWilson Blair medium for salmonella typhiNote:A medium can be placed in one or many of the above mentioned categories as per its use.Some commonly used media with multiple uses are:MediaEnrichedSelectiveDifferentialBlood agarYes, the primary purpose of BA is to isolate bacterial pathogens from clinical specimens.NoYes, used to differentiate a, b & g hemolytic organismsChocolate agarYes, primary purpose of CA is to isolate especially fastidious bacterial pathogens, like neisseria & hemophilius that do not grows on BANoNoMacConkey agarNoYes, selective for Gram -ve bacteriaYes, to differentiate between lactose fermenters and non fermentersPhenylethyl alcohol agar (PEA)Yes, PEA is BA to which phenylethyl alcohol is addedYes, PEA is selective for Gram +ve bacteriaNoThayer Martin agarYes, TM is chocolate agar to which additional nutrients have been addedYes, TM is selective for Nesseria gonorrhoae & meningitisNoMannitol salt agar (MSA)NoYes, MSA is selective for organisms that can tolerate high salt concentrationYes, used to differentiate between mannitol fermenters & non fermenters
